Purpose of the
Document
To show the steps needed to control the Web Services hosted on the Oracle
Service Bus
Steps
Take a backup of
the existing configuration (Take a backup of the fmwconfig folder in the Domain
Home Directory)
Login to the
service Bus console and configure the SMTP Server as per the below screen in
the System -> SMTP
Server -> smtp server section
Click on Create and then update the
values as per the following or the relevant values of the SMTP Server and the
Port Number in the Server URL and Port Number Section respectively
Save the changes

Login to the em
console of the osb
In the Home Page
Select SOA -> Service Bus
Select Operations and click on Search
This will list all the web services
Select the web service which you wish to stop
Select Offline Endpoint URLs and select Monitoring enabled and click
apply
Got to the previous tab and click “toggle URL state” if it is not
appearing as offline and the state should be show as offline as below
Tip: It will be greyed out state.
You need to click on the state below (it will be online to begin with ) and
then you can toggle the URL state.
Vice versa also is true That is
if you wish to mark the URL online, click on the state and then click toggle
URL state.
This will make the WSDL unavailable and the recipient will receive an
email alert
To make the webservice available once again, you need to uncheck the
“Offline
Endpoint URLs” and select Monitoring enabled and click apply
